Output 6e8f8d3dd828c61b93f5bf70e457ec052d2bb07ddf55d7f49e9eef16cb75183b:1

value
816217247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a1eef8acfec64a276693a60b229549bd70f69c OP_EQUAL
address
38x5J2vQknMLPFxLo3CxwhczxsvTBbnhyL
transaction
6e8f8d3dd828c61b93f5bf70e457ec052d2bb07ddf55d7f49e9eef16cb75183b
confirmations
226628
spent
true